Former  Governor’s Aide Allegedly Linked to Kidnap Case, Bandit Network


Fresh controversy has emerged in Katsina State following allegations against a former government aide identified as Nura Aliyu Garwa, who reportedly served as Senior Special Assistant (SSA) on Community Development to the Katsina State Governor.


According to claims circulating online, Garwa has been accused of being the alleged mastermind behind the kidnapping of an eight-year-old boy.

 

Reports further allege that he may have connections with armed groups and bandit gangs operating within the state.
The former aide recently resigned from his position in government and was said to have declared his intention to contest for a seat in the Katsina State House of Assembly, a move that has now attracted heightened public attention following the allegations.

 


The claims have triggered reactions among residents and social media users, with many calling for a thorough investigation to establish the facts surrounding the accusations. Concerns have also been raised over the implications of individuals seeking public office while facing serious allegations tied to insecurity.

 


As of the time of filing this report, authorities have not officially released a statement confirming the allegations or announced any formal charges. Independent verification of the claims also remains ongoing.

 


Security analysts continue to stress the importance of due process, emphasizing that allegations should be properly investigated and that all individuals remain innocent until proven guilty under the law.
More details are expected as the situation develops.
